Completing the KYC (Identity Verification)
Upload a clear image of your ID document and a selfie. This step is mandatory for all users in Uzbekistan.
- Why it matters: KYC unlocks the ability to deposit, bet, and withdraw funds. Without it, your account is restricted.
- Expected result: Your account status changes to “Pending Verification.”
- Practical tip: Take your photo in a well-lit room against a plain background to ensure the document text is readable.
- Common mistake: Uploading an expired ID or a document that is damaged. Always check the expiration date first.
| Document Type | Accepted Formats | Key Requirements |
|---|---|---|
| Passport | JPG, PNG, PDF | Must clearly show the photo page and your personal details. |
| National ID | JPG, PNG, PDF | Both front and back sides are required. |
| Utility Bill | JPG, PNG, PDF | Must be dated within the last 3 months for address confirmation. |
Before you upload, ensure that all images are high resolution and the text is fully readable. Blurry or incomplete document submissions are the primary reason for verification failure. Keep these documents saved in a secure folder on your device for easy access during the upload process.
⚠ Common Mistake: Many users try to take a photo of their ID with a reflective surface or shadow. This often results in a rejection. Place the document on a flat surface and take the photo directly from above.

Best Practices for a Secure Paripulse Experience
Security is a shared responsibility. Following these practical recommendations will help you maintain a safe and enjoyable experience on the platform.
First and foremost, protect your account credentials. Never share your password or PIN with anyone, and be wary of phishing attempts that ask for your login details. Paripulse will never ask for your password via email or phone.
-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): This adds an extra layer of security, requiring a code from your phone in addition to your password.
- Use a Dedicated Email Address: Create a separate email account specifically for your gaming activities to keep communications organized and secure.
- Review Account Activity Regularly: Check your login history and transaction history periodically for any unauthorized access.
- Set Deposit Limits: Use the platform’s responsible gaming tools to set daily or weekly deposit limits to manage your spending.
Best Practice: Log out of your account when using a shared or public device. Clear your browser cache after each session to ensure no personal data is left behind.
